O R D E R
*********** This writ petition has been filed for a Mandamus seeking for a direction to the first respondent to issue passport to the petitioner based on his passport application dated 23.03.2021, within a time frame to be fixed by this Court. 2.The petitioner has applied for passport with the first respondent on 23.03.2021. The said application has not been processed by the first respondent on the ground that an FIR is pending against the petitioner in Crime No.108 of 2021. The petitioner has been charged for the offences under Section 379 IPC r/w. Section 21(1) of the Mines and Minerals (Development and Regulation) Act, 1957.
3.It is settled law that pendency of an FIR does not prohibit the first respondent from issuing passport. It is for the first https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/ 1/2
W.P.[MD]No.21088 of 2021 respondent to consider each and every case on merits and decide as to whether the applicant is entitled for passport or not. Therefore, no prejudice would be caused to the first respondent if the petitioner's passport application dated 23.03.2021 is considered on merits and in accordance with law after affording a fair hearing to the petitioner including granting him the right of personal hearing. 4.Accordingly, this Court directs the first respondent to consider the petitioner's passport application dated 23.03.2021, requesting for grant of passport in his name and pass final orders on merits and in accordance with law after affording a fair hearing to the petitioner including granting him an opportunity of personal hearing within a period of eight [8] we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
5.With the above direction, this Writ Petition stands disposed of. There shall be no order as to costs.
